How to Ensure a Perfect Bug-Proof Fit
A mesh screen is only as good as its seal against the playpen frame. Always pull the elastic or toggle points taut to ensure no gaps exist between the floor of the playpen and the edge of the screen.
If there is excess material, fold it over or secure it with additional clips rather than letting it drape loosely. A loose bottom allows crawling insects to find entry points, effectively rendering the mesh useless. A tight, flush fit is the difference between a secure environment and a false sense of security.
What to Look For in a Durable Mesh Screen
Prioritize screens that feature reinforced seams, as these are the first points to fail under the tension of repeated stretching. Breathability is equally important; test the material by holding it to your face to ensure airflow is not restricted by overly thick synthetic fibers.
Look for UV-resistant coatings on outdoor-rated models, as constant sunlight will rapidly degrade cheaper polyester meshes, making them brittle and prone to tearing. A durable screen should feel substantial to the touch without being heavy or rigid. Focus on high-density polyethylene or reinforced nylon for the longest service life.
Storing and Cleaning Your Playpen Screen
Mesh is a magnet for dust, pollen, and debris, which can eventually clog the small holes and reduce airflow. Hand-wash screens in a basin with mild soap and cold water, then air-dry them completely before folding for storage. Avoid machine drying, as the heat can permanently warp the elastic edges or melt the fine mesh fibers.
When storing, ensure the screen is completely dry to prevent mold or mildew growth, especially if packed away in a moist environment like a shed or an RV compartment. Folding the net carefully, rather than stuffing it into a bag, prevents deep creases that can weaken the fabric over time. Consistent maintenance will significantly extend the life of your equipment.
Beyond Bugs: Sun Protection and Other Uses
While the primary function is insect defense, these screens also serve as a psychological barrier that can help a child focus on rest. In busy or distracting environments, the mesh provides a gentle filter that lowers light levels and reduces visual stimulation.
Consider layering a mesh screen with a secondary, lightweight sun-blocking fabric if the playpen is situated in direct, harsh light. This creates a multi-stage defense system that handles both pests and solar heat. Always monitor the internal temperature when using multiple covers, as increased layers will naturally restrict airflow and heat dissipation.
